Boston’s vibrant cultural landscape is made possible by leaders on a quest for change. Join the Network for Arts Administrators of Color as we hear from arts luminaries whose mission-driven work with underrepresented communities celebrates the stories and people within them. Learn about their triumphs, the challenges to overcome, and what these forerunners envision for the future of Boston. Amplifying Voices is the second in a series of three conversations shining a spotlight on people of color in arts leadership in Boston. Building on Paving the Way: A Conversation with leaders of Color in the Arts, held at the Pao Arts Center in December 2017, Amplifying Voices gets to the heart of why we do this work, the intentional communities we serve, and the great impact we provide to Boston’s cultural economy.
